To reduce a fraction to the lowest terms equivalent: divide the numerator and denominator by their greatest common factor, GCF
To calculate the greatest common factor, GCF:
- 1. Factor the numerator and the denominator (into prime factors), build their prime factorizations.
- 2. Multiply all their common prime factors, taken by the lowest exponents.
1. Factor the numerator and the denominator:
To factor a number (into prime factors) - or, in other words, to break it down to prime factors - or, in other words, to build its prime factorization: find the prime numbers that multiply together to get that number.

Yet another method to reduce the fraction
To reduce a fraction without calculating the GCF: factor its numerator and denominator, then all the common prime factors are easily identified and crossed out.
